Confusion

Pronunciation: /kənˈfjuːʒən/

Confusion (noun)

  1. a state of not being sure what is happening or what to do.
  2. a situation where things are messy or not organized.
  3. a mistake in understanding something or someone.

Examples

  • She felt confusion about the new policy.
  • There was confusion over which path to take.

Common collocations: cause confusion, state of confusion, total confusion, amidst confusion, clear up confusion
